Moving to a new environment is often challenging, and this is the case with Mary Grace. She and her brother, Donny, were expected to go to California and stay with their grandparents for some time while their parents went away on missionary work. There, they started adjusting to their new home, school, and friends in California. But when an intriguing mystery arises, Mary Grace realizes she must draw on her newfound confidence and connections to solve it. With her brother Donny by her side and a group of grandmothers who are her friends, she is determined to unravel the case while continuing to adjust to her unfamiliar new home.

I love that this beautifully written novel highlights the immeasurable value of family and true friendship. Its messages around loyalty, acceptance, and embracing life's unexpected turns prove inspiring for readers of all ages. Both children and adults will find nuggets of wisdom to take away.

The characters in Donny and Mary Grace's California Adventures by Catherine A. Pepe are multi-dimensional, and their realistic bond leaps off the pages. Donny's endearing personality and humor add an extra layer of heart. Pepe has done a commendable job capturing the joys and challenges of Down syndrome with compassion. Donny's cheerfulness caught my heart and made me fall in love with him. I know that the motivation for writing this book is because the author has experience with a person with Down syndrome, and she succeeded in capturing what a blessing it is to have them in one's life.

I recommend Donny and Mary Grace's California Adventures by Catherine A. Pepe to those seeking a satisfying blend of entertainment and life lessons. This book was exceptionally well-edited and had a well-delivered plot. This is the kind of book I would be happy to read over and over again. There was nothing about the book that I disliked, and because of this, I am rating it 5 out of 5 stars.
